What You Can Expect From the Husky Experience in Rovaniemi

Rovaniemi: One Hour Husky Experience - What You Can Expect From the Husky Experience in Rovaniemi

When you book this tour, you’ll begin with a pick-up from your accommodation in central Rovaniemi. The scenic drive to the husky farm sets the tone—expect snow-covered trees, crisp air, and a sense of anticipation. Once there, you’ll receive a warm welcome from the dogs and their owners, along with a brief safety briefing to ensure everyone’s comfort and safety during the ride.

Meeting the Huskies and Learning about Their Care

This part of the experience really stood out. Many reviews mention how friendly and gentle these dogs are, and how much they love interaction. You’ll have time to cuddle and take photos with these furry athletes, capturing moments that you’ll cherish long after your trip. It’s not just photo ops; you’ll also hear stories about how huskies are raised, trained, and cared for in the cold climate of Lapland. One reviewer appreciated the informative aspect, noting that it helped them understand what it takes to keep these animals healthy and happy.

The Sled Ride: A Brief but Exciting Journey

Next, you’ll hop onto a sled that is pulled by a team of enthusiastic huskies. The ride covers about 500-800 meters, which isn’t long but offers a thrilling taste of Arctic sledding. The sled ride isn’t self-mushing, meaning you’re mainly a passenger, but that’s part of what makes it accessible for most. Expect to glide through snowy forests and open landscapes, with the huskies happily pulling you along.

Many visitors describe the ride as “fun” and “exhilarating,” even if it’s over fairly quickly. One reviewer noted, “The ride was short but sweet, and the dogs looked like they were loving every minute.” The views are exactly what you’d imagine—white snow, tall pines, and a peaceful winter silence broken only by the panting of the dogs.

Warming Up and Learning More

After your ride, you’ll move into a heated hut to warm up. Here, a hot drink and cookies await, making for a cozy end to the outdoor activity. This part is especially appreciated in colder months, giving you a chance to relax and chat about your experience. The hosts are usually happy to answer questions, share stories, and ensure everyone feels comfortable.

FAQs

Is the husky sled ride suitable for children?
Yes, the ride is brief and designed to be accessible, making it suitable for most ages. Kids will enjoy cuddling the dogs and taking photos.

How long is the sled ride?
The sled ride covers about 500-800 meters, so it’s a quick but fun experience. It’s not a self-mushing tour, just a passenger ride.

Are hotel transfers included?
Yes, hotel pickup and drop-off in central Rovaniemi are included, making logistics simple and convenient.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, which adds flexibility to your trip planning.

What’s the weather like during the tour?
Expect cold, snowy Lapland weather, so dress warmly—layers, waterproof clothing, and sturdy boots are recommended.

Is the experience educational?
Definitely. You’ll learn about raising and caring for huskies, gaining insights into their training and daily life in Lapland.
